I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C# Discussion :

intégration de php en asp


Sujet :

C#

  1. #1
    Membre confirmé
    Inscrit en
    Janvier 2008
    Messages
    57
    Détails du profil
    Informations forums :
    Inscription : Janvier 2008
    Messages : 57
    Par défaut intégration de php en asp
    bonsoir,
    je veux réaliser une application web (avec les services web)pour une agence de voyage (réservation pour un vol et un hotel)
    j'ai préparé la partie de réservation de vol en C#.NET et ASP.NET avec SQL Server 2005
    et j'ai déja préparer la partie administrateur de l'hotel avec PHP et mysql.
    mes question: est ce que je peux préparer la partie de réservation dans un hotel(partie client) en ASP.NET et C#.NET avec mysql par les web services???
    et est ce que je peux intégrer les pages (en ASP) dans mon site qu 'est en PHP ou l'inverse si mon site en ASP, est ce que je peux intégrer les pages en PHP

    merci de m'informer si il y'a des tutoriaux ou des sites qui m'aident à comprendre ces questions .
    merci pour votre collaboration.

  2. #2
    Membre Expert
    Homme Profil pro
    Inscrit en
    Juillet 2007
    Messages
    1 277
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Réunion

    Informations forums :
    Inscription : Juillet 2007
    Messages : 1 277
    Par défaut
    IIS permet de faire fonctionner à la fois PHP et ASP.NET en installant IIS, PHP pour Windows et Microsoft .NET. Apache permet de faire fonctionner à la fois PHP et ASP.NET en installant Apache, PHP et Mono (il est possible par contre que le support soit limité au framework 1.1 voir 2.0 à vérifier sur leur site). Il est donc possible de faire cohabiter sur un même serveur des applications PHP et ASP.NET.

    .NET sait communiquer avec une base MySQL soit via ODBC, soit via un fournisseur de donnée spécifique (téléchargeable depuis le site de MySQL). .NET et PHP peuvent également communiquer entre eux via les webservices (qui est une norme indépendante du langage).

    Une raison à ce mix technologique ?

  3. #3
    Membre confirmé
    Inscrit en
    Janvier 2008
    Messages
    57
    Détails du profil
    Informations forums :
    Inscription : Janvier 2008
    Messages : 57
    Par défaut
    Une raison à ce mix technologique ?

    mon 1er page contient un menu (vol, gestion d'hotel, réservation hotel)
    vol en ASP.NET , C#.NET et SQL Server 2005 (avec web service)
    hotel (partie administrateur) en PHP et mysql (sans web service)
    hotel (partie client) en PHP ou ASP.NET (j'ai pas encore fixé) et mysql (avec web service)

    mon problème:
    si j'utlise master page (en asp) , est ce que je peux intégrer dedans des pages d'extension .php
    ou l'inverse si j'ai une page en php (comme master page), est ce que je peux intégrer deadans des pages d'extensions .aspx
    franchement cet astuce n'est pas encore claire à 100% car j'ai essayé d'appeler une page .php (via un lien) dans ma page principale en aspx; il s'affiche des balises php <? et des codes de programmation etc

  4. #4
    Membre confirmé
    Inscrit en
    Janvier 2008
    Messages
    57
    Détails du profil
    Informations forums :
    Inscription : Janvier 2008
    Messages : 57
    Par défaut
    salut, j'ai oublié de vous informer que mon windows est XP service pack2, et mon 1er application est en php 1.6 . et pour ma 2eme application j'utilise le visual studio2005
    est ce que .NET e php 1.6 sont compatible??

  5. #5
    Membre Expert
    Homme Profil pro
    Inscrit en
    Juillet 2007
    Messages
    1 277
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Réunion

    Informations forums :
    Inscription : Juillet 2007
    Messages : 1 277
    Par défaut
    .NET et PHP ne sont pas compatibles.

    Au niveau des webservices, on parle d'interopérabilité : c'est à dire que .NET peut consommer des services web créés avec PHP et vice-versa. Par contre, il ne sera jamais possible de mixer dans une application des pages ASP.NET, des pages PHP qui exécutent un code dans le même contexte (à savoir en partageant une session).

  6. #6
    Membre confirmé
    Inscrit en
    Janvier 2008
    Messages
    57
    Détails du profil
    Informations forums :
    Inscription : Janvier 2008
    Messages : 57
    Par défaut
    salut,
    excusez moi , j'ai utulisé easyphp 1.6 (php 4.2.0,apache 1.3.2.4, mysql 3.23.49, phpmyadmin 2.26) pour créer mon 1er application . et pour ma 2eme application j'utilise le visual studio2005
    est ce que .NET e easyphp 1.6 sont compatible?? (je sais pa si la syntaxe ou la façon de poser la question est juste ou non, car j'ai aucune idée )

    d'aprés ce que j'ai compris de ton explication: il faux choisir par exemple php pour créer tous mon site avec son menu(vol, reservation hotel, gestion de l'hotel) si je clique sur "vol" je remplie le formulaire (qu'est en php) et si je clique sur le bouton j'appele le service web "vol" (qu'est en C#.NET et sql server2005) => c'est juste ??

    merci beaucoup

  7. #7
    Membre chevronné
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Décembre 2004
    Messages
    304
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 43
    Localisation : Tunisie

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: High Tech - Électronique et micro-électronique

    Informations forums :
    Inscription : Décembre 2004
    Messages : 304
    Par défaut
    Juste

    Mais il ne sera jamais possible d'ecrire du code ASP avec du code PHP.

    Je te conseillerai de te concentrer sur l'une des deux téchnologies ASP ou PHP; du moins lorsque tu developpe une meme application (site).

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Choisir PHP ou ASP.NET ?
    Par discogarden dans le forum Général Conception Web
    Réponses: 81
    Dernier message: 31/12/2009, 18h11
  2. [PHP-JS] intégration java-php
    Par morticia2005 dans le forum Langage
    Réponses: 1
    Dernier message: 21/12/2005, 00h44
  3. Convertir un script php en asp
    Par tibow dans le forum ASP
    Réponses: 3
    Dernier message: 20/11/2005, 02h14
  4. [JSP/Tomcat] Intégration de PHP dans Java
    Par milhouz_deglingos dans le forum Tomcat et TomEE
    Réponses: 3
    Dernier message: 17/08/2005, 12h02
  5. equivalence du isset() php en asp
    Par jecht dans le forum ASP
    Réponses: 4
    Dernier message: 13/05/2004, 14h48

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o